Making Financial Arrangements After Divorce

icon1 Posted by DivorceLine in Divorce Articles, Divorce Forms on 01 29th, 2026 | no responses

When in marriage, couples usually believe secure particularly if the husband is earning well in his profession. For families with both spouses working, finances are not a lot of a issue as well. But no matter how stable a couple’s financial scenario is, every thing can fall apart once they determine to divorce.

It’s typically the financial aspect that hits a couple the hardest throughout divorce. A wife who is completely dependent on her husband might think helpless when their marriage ends. Even among working couples, settling their finances and dividing their conjugal properties can be a challenging job.

But there’s a answer to every single difficulty and couples in an uncontested divorce method are in the ideal position to quickly settle their financial problems. This means they mutually agree to end their marriage with out putting the blame on one yet another. In this scenario, no one is at fault which means that there is no will need to offer evidences just before the court in order for the divorce petition to be granted.

Couples who can go through an uncontested divorce are able to choose well and feel well of their future scenario and that of their youngsters. It’s best to put aside hostile emotions and differences whilst working out a remedy to the scenario and specially where kids are concerned.

Uncontested divorce kits make it simple to organize and accomplish the legal forms with out the require to hire a lawyer. They’re both time and cash saving and as a result, very useful to couples who will need to have their divorce granted in a short period of time.

The do-it-yourself divorce papers contain various forms that require to be filled up and submitted to the local court. The financial statement form is where the financial details such as the child help and alimony are included. If you’re not certain about this aspect, It’s best that you seek the help of a financial planner to guide you on what to do in terms of spending budget planning for the future and arriving at a proper settlement with your spouse.

Negotiating child assist and alimony is essential so that both spouses have a clear view of the financial scenario. Child help is not just limited to the father simply because depending on the scenario, a mother could possibly also be needed to pay a father. Most usually, the non-custodial parent is the one that supplies the financial assist. But in case of a joint custody, either one (the major income earner) must pay the other. Typically, the quantity depends on how significantly the parent earns and the quantity of time the child spends with each and every of them.

The objective of a child aid is to make sure that the child (or kids) moves on with life with sufficient food, clothing and the proper education. As a parent, the responsibility to supply for the kids’s wants should really generally stay a priority even after divorce.
